Plans to unveil a bust of Marcus Garvey in Ethiopia revealed

Final Call News Photo: Marcus Garvey Photo: A&E Television Networks / Wikimedia Commons NNPA Now, 81 years after his death, officials in Ethiopia plan to unveil a bronze sculpture in Addis Ababa to honor the legacy of Marcus Mosiah Garvey, the Pan African independence movement architect. According to a news release, the sculpture highlights Ethiopia as a focal point for Pan-Africanists to engage in constructing a unifying African heritage and destiny. “Our history began, in a sense, with Ethiopia,” Dr. Julius Garvey, Marcus Garvey’s youngest son, told NNPA Newswire.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. once called Marcus Garvey the first “man on a mass scale and level to give millions of Negroes a sense of dignity and destiny.”
